Explain how the skin of reptiles adaptive for terrestial existence. (Is your skin also adaptive for a terrestial existence?)
Solution
Reptiles posess many adaptations that permits them to live in dry conditions. One of the important adaptation of reptiles is their skin.
Reptiles have dry, cornified skin without glands and with scales. The thick, scaly skin helps conserve water inside their bodies and prevent water loss. This is an essential feature that helps them survive not only on land, but in dry, desert areas as well. The skin functions as water proof cover to conserve water inside, so they do not feel the need of water unlike other animals. This important adaptation has helped reptiles to survive in terestrial habitats.
